Targeted at the lively and youthful customers, Nissan today launched the limited edition Groove at Rs 11,45,123 (ex-showroom Delhi). The car is based on the XL variant and will be limited to 250 units. Nissan claims that the car has been introduced with benefits worth Rs 30,000 at no additional cost.
In this new Terrano Groove edition, Nissan has added ambient lighting, branded fabric floor mats and Led scuff plates on the doors. In addition to these features, the Nissan Terrano Groove edition has also been fitted with a new speaker system from Rockford Fosgate. There are changes on the outside too. The fog lamps, tail lamps and the tailgate now get chrome highlights. And the roof gets a matte black wrap.
Commenting on Nissan's latest limited edition, Guillaume Sicard, President – Nissan India Operations said, “With the Groove edition, we want to reach out to individuals who like their cars to reflect their dynamic lifestyle. We are confident that the new additions will make the Terrano even more appealing to them.”
Along with the launch of the car, Nissan also announced a new advertising campaign featuring Bollywood actor Sushant Singh Rajput who will star in a youth-oriented television commercial.
